信息编程是一门什么学科

不及物动词 其他 11

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    信息编程是一门涵盖计算机科学、信息技术和软件工程等领域的学科。它主要研究如何使用计算机语言和工具来处理、存储和传输信息。

    首先,信息编程关注的是如何设计和开发计算机程序来处理各种类型的信息。这包括数据的输入、输出、存储和处理等方面。信息编程的核心是编写代码,通过编程语言来实现各种功能,如算法、数据结构、逻辑控制等。通过编程,可以将抽象的问题转化为计算机可以理解和执行的指令。

    其次,信息编程还涉及到如何使用各种工具和技术来处理和管理信息。这包括数据库管理系统、网络编程、数据挖掘、人工智能等方面。通过这些工具和技术,可以更高效地处理和利用信息,实现自动化和智能化的功能。

    此外,信息编程还与软件工程密切相关。它包括软件开发的整个生命周期,包括需求分析、设计、编码、测试、部署和维护等。信息编程需要具备良好的软件工程实践,以保证开发出高质量、可靠和易于维护的软件系统。

    总的来说,信息编程是一门综合性的学科,它涵盖了计算机科学、信息技术和软件工程等多个领域。通过学习信息编程,人们可以掌握处理和管理信息的技能,为实现信息化的社会做出贡献。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    信息编程是计算机科学中的一个学科领域,也被称为信息技术编程。它涵盖了利用计算机编程语言来处理和管理信息的技术和方法。以下是关于信息编程的五个要点:

    1. 数据处理:信息编程主要关注如何处理和管理数据。它涉及使用编程语言来创建和操作数据结构,例如数组、列表、字典等。信息编程可以帮助我们从大量的数据中提取有用的信息,进行数据分析和可视化等操作。

    2. 算法和逻辑:信息编程需要掌握算法和逻辑的基本原理。算法是解决问题的一系列步骤,而逻辑是编程语言中的控制流程和条件判断。信息编程需要了解不同的算法和逻辑结构,并能够将其应用于实际问题的解决。

    3. 编程语言:信息编程需要掌握至少一种编程语言,例如Python、Java、C++等。不同的编程语言有不同的语法和特性,选择合适的编程语言取决于具体的应用场景和需求。信息编程还需要了解如何使用编程工具和开发环境来编写、调试和运行代码。

    4. 软件开发:信息编程也涉及到软件开发的过程和方法。这包括需求分析、系统设计、编码、测试和部署等阶段。信息编程需要掌握软件开发的基本原理和技巧,能够开发出高质量、可靠和易于维护的软件系统。

    5. 应用领域:信息编程在各个领域都有广泛的应用。例如,在金融领域,信息编程可以用于开发金融交易系统和风险管理模型;在医疗领域,信息编程可以用于医学图像处理和健康数据分析;在教育领域,信息编程可以用于开发教育游戏和在线学习平台等。信息编程的应用范围非常广泛,几乎涵盖了所有需要处理和管理信息的领域。

    综上所述,信息编程是一门计算机科学中的学科,它涵盖了数据处理、算法和逻辑、编程语言、软件开发和各个应用领域等方面的知识和技能。掌握信息编程可以帮助我们更好地处理和管理信息,解决实际问题,并在各个领域中发挥作用。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    信息编程是一门综合性学科,它融合了计算机科学、信息技术和软件工程等多个领域的知识。信息编程的核心目标是通过编程语言和技术,对信息进行处理、存储、分析和传输,从而实现各种应用需求。

    信息编程涉及的主要内容包括算法设计、数据结构、软件开发、网络编程、数据库管理、人工智能、机器学习等。它既关注计算机科学的基础理论和算法,又注重实际应用和技术创新。信息编程的学习和应用,可以帮助人们解决现实生活中的各种问题,提高工作效率和生活质量。

    下面将从方法、操作流程等方面介绍信息编程的学科内容。

    一、算法设计与数据结构
    算法是信息编程的核心,它是解决问题的步骤和方法的描述。算法设计的目标是找到一个高效的解决方案,使得计算机能够在合理的时间内完成任务。常见的算法设计方法包括分治法、贪心法、动态规划等。数据结构是算法的基础,它用于组织和存储数据。常见的数据结构有数组、链表、栈、队列、树、图等。了解不同的数据结构和算法,可以帮助我们选择适合的解决方案,并优化程序的执行效率。

    二、软件开发
    软件开发是信息编程的重要组成部分,它涵盖了软件需求分析、系统设计、编码实现、测试和维护等阶段。软件开发过程中,需要选择合适的开发工具和编程语言,如Java、C++、Python等。同时,需要掌握良好的编码规范和软件设计原则,以保证开发出高质量、可维护的软件。

    三、网络编程
    网络编程是信息编程的重要应用领域,它涉及到网络通信、协议和服务器等方面。网络编程可以帮助我们实现分布式计算、远程访问和数据传输等功能。在网络编程中,我们需要了解TCP/IP协议、HTTP协议、socket编程等知识,以及常用的网络编程框架和库。

    四、数据库管理
    数据库管理是信息编程的重要技术之一,它用于存储和管理大量的数据。数据库管理涉及到数据库设计、数据模型、查询语言、事务处理等方面。常见的数据库管理系统有MySQL、Oracle、SQL Server等。了解数据库管理的原理和技术,可以帮助我们高效地存储和检索数据。

    五、人工智能与机器学习
    人工智能和机器学习是信息编程的前沿研究领域,它们致力于使计算机能够模拟人类的智能行为和学习能力。人工智能和机器学习涉及到模式识别、数据挖掘、自然语言处理等方面。在人工智能和机器学习中,常用的算法包括神经网络、支持向量机、决策树等。掌握人工智能和机器学习的知识,可以帮助我们构建智能化的系统和应用。

    综上所述,信息编程是一门综合性学科,涵盖了算法设计、数据结构、软件开发、网络编程、数据库管理、人工智能和机器学习等多个方面的知识。通过学习信息编程,我们可以掌握处理信息的方法和技术,解决实际问题,提高工作效率和生活质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部